Why Restore Sash Windows?


Restoration of sash windows, instead of replacement, features numerous advantages:

Let's take a more detailed look at these aspects in the table listed below:

Benefit

Explanation

Preservation of Heritage

Keeps the architectural style intact and honors historic significance.

Cost-Effectiveness

Often cheaper than complete replacement; can conserve on heating bills.

Ecological Benefits

Lessens waste and promotes sustainable practices in home maintenance.

Regional Restoration Services

Many local sash window repair specialists offer a series of services:

Service

Description

Repairing Sashes

Fixing and reconditioning existing sash mechanisms that may be stuck, deformed, or broken.

Draft Proofing

Enhancing energy effectiveness by sealing drafts without compromising aesthetic appeals.

Repainting and Finishing

Removing, repainting, or re-staining to bring back the window's initial look.

Glazing

Changing damaged or broken glass with historically proper choices.

Security Enhancements

Installing brand-new locks or reinforcements to enhance security and security of windows.

The Restoration Process


A typical sash window repair procedure involves numerous in-depth steps. Understanding these can assist homeowners set practical expectations.

Steps Involved in Sash Window Restoration:

  1. Initial Assessment: Experts will assess the windows to recognize required repairs and restoration work.
  2. Disassembly: The sashes will be thoroughly gotten rid of from the frames for more accessible repairs.
  3. Repair and Refurbishment: Damaged wood is repaired or changed, and all moving parts are restored to make sure smooth operation.
  4. Re-glazing: Experts will replace old or broken glass with new, either single or double-glazed choices, depending on the homeowner's choices.
  5. Draft Proofing: Adding seals or other draft-proofing steps will help improve energy performance.
  6. Ending up Touches: Finally, the windows will be painted or stained, adhering to historic accuracy where needed.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)


1. The length of time does the sash window repair process normally take?

The timeline for restoration can differ based on the condition of the windows and the level of the work required. On average, the process can take anywhere from a couple of days to a couple of weeks.

2. Will bring back sash windows enhance energy efficiency?

Yes, bring back sash windows can significantly enhance energy effectiveness, particularly when draft-proofing steps and double glazing are introduced.

3. Can all sash windows be brought back?

While most sash windows can be brought back, those that are seriously damaged may require more substantial repair work or partial replacements.

4. Is sash window restoration more economical than replacement?

For numerous property owners, repair is more cost-effective than replacement, particularly considering the preservation of the home's value and character.
